Abstract

ABSTRACT JAYOMA, MIGUELITO SALAS, University of the Philippines at Los BaRos, B.S. Biology. -Cytology and Embryo Sac Development of Manila Palm [Veitchia merrillii (Becc.) H.E. Moore, Arecaceae/Palmae].

ADVISER: Dr. William Sm. Gruezo

Chromosome number, behavior and embryo sac development in young ovules of V. merrillii were studied. Chromosome number was 2n = 23. Infrequent number of 2n = 26 and 24 were also observed. In general meiotic chromosome behavior is normal, except for some laggards at anaphase I and II which were due to delayed disjunction of late-aligning bivalents at metaphase. Pollen viability and fertility of V. merrillii was 96.7% . The embryo sac development of V. merrillii was that of somatic apospory type which is a mode of apomixis in angiosperms. In the developmental process, somatic cells enlarges, vacuolated and a series of karyokinetic divisions forms the eight nucleate embryo sac. However, nuclei formed have an unreduced genome.
